Smart diapers utilize sensors connected to mobile applications to enhance the care of infants and the elderly. The sensors detect leaks and send alerts to parents or caregivers. Integrated with wetness sensors, smart diapers transmit signals to nearby receivers, providing timely alerts for effective care.
The primary product types in smart diapers are designed for babies and adults. Adult diapers cater to elderly individuals facing daily issues such as dementia, urinary/faecal incontinence, diarrhea, or mobility limitations. Applications include universal care, community care, and clinical care, with distribution occurring through various channels such as online and retail.

Tariffs are influencing the smart diapers market by increasing costs of imported sensors, conductive materials, microchips, and textile substrates used in connected diaper products. Asia-Pacific manufacturing centers are significantly affected due to export-oriented production, while North America and Europe face higher product pricing and procurement costs for healthcare providers. These tariffs are impacting affordability and slowing adoption in cost-sensitive markets. At the same time, they are driving local sourcing of materials, regional assembly initiatives, and innovation in cost-effective smart diaper designs to support long-term market scalability.

The smart diapers market size has grown strongly in recent years. It will grow from $9.74 billion in 2025 to $10.56 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.4%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to growth in infant care product demand, increasing elderly population requiring assisted care, rising awareness of hygiene monitoring technologies, early adoption of wearable health sensors, expansion of connected healthcare devices.
The smart diapers market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$14.51 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.3%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to growing demand for home-based patient monitoring, increasing integration with digital health platforms, rising adoption in elder care facilities, expansion of smart healthcare ecosystems, continuous improvements in sensor accuracy and comfort. Major trends in the forecast period include increasing adoption of sensor-enabled diaper solutions, rising demand for remote infant and elderly monitoring, growing integration of mobile health applications, expansion of disposable and reusable smart diaper options, enhanced focus on caregiver convenience.
The rise in birth rates is expected to drive the growth of the smart diapers market in the coming years. Birth rate refers to the number of live births per thousand people in a given year, and it is increasing due to a higher number of registered births across various countries. As the infant population grows, smart diapers support this trend by helping detect health concerns such as constipation, skin rashes, allergies, and incontinence in children. For example, in October 2025, the Australian Bureau of Statistics (ABS), an Australian government organization, reported 292,318 registered births in 2024, representing a 1.9% increase, or 5,320 additional births, compared to 2023. Consequently, higher birth rates are contributing to the growth of the smart diapers market.
Major companies in the smart diapers market are concentrating on technological advancements, such as integrated moisture sensors and real-time health monitoring, to offer parents convenient solutions that improve infant care and facilitate proactive health management. The integrated moisture sensor is a straightforward, low-cost device that detects changes in humidity, allowing it to signal wetness in smart diapers and other health monitoring applications by converting water absorption into electrical signals. For example, in February 2023, Pennsylvania State University, a US-based public research university, developed a low-cost, hand-drawn hydration sensor that can be integrated into 'smart diapers' to identify wetness and notify caregivers. This innovative technology aims to improve immediate care in daycares and hospitals, with potential applications in broader health monitoring.
In October 2025, Mammoth Brands, a U.S.-based consumer packaged goods company, acquired Coterie for an undisclosed amount. Through this acquisition, Mammoth Brands aims to enter and expand within the baby care segment by leveraging its infrastructure and omnichannel capabilities to scale Coterie's operations and accelerate growth in the diapers and wipes market. Coterie Baby Inc. is a U.S.-based brand that provides high-performance, safety-focused diapers, wipes, and other baby care products.
